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| [Minor] Add erroring to smtp parse date | Vsevolod Stakhov | 2020-10-06 | 1 | -1/+1 |
| | |||||
* | [Fix] Deal with double eqsigns when decoding headers | Vsevolod Stakhov | 2020-09-01 | 1 | -2/+3 |
| | |||||
* | [Minor] Plug memory leak | Vsevolod Stakhov | 2020-08-29 | 1 | -5/+7 |
| | |||||
* | [Fix] Another try to fix email names parsing | Vsevolod Stakhov | 2020-08-05 | 1 | -4/+4 |
| | | | | Related to: 772964f83b82f6d597e22c8b4d08220ab7df3f43#diff-677ba97322f6447774f021d51913b00b | ||||
* | [Minor] Save zero terminated string properly | Vsevolod Stakhov | 2020-07-27 | 1 | -2/+5 |
| | |||||
* | [Fix] Restore support for `for` and `id` parts in received headers | Vsevolod Stakhov | 2020-07-27 | 1 | -0/+18 |
| | |||||
* | [Minor] Fix config-less tests | Vsevolod Stakhov | 2020-05-19 | 1 | -4/+9 |
| | |||||
* | [Minor] Add `max_recipients` config knob | Vsevolod Stakhov | 2020-05-19 | 1 | -5/+6 |
| | |||||
* | [Minor] Add a simple way to limit number of email addresses | Vsevolod Stakhov | 2020-05-19 | 1 | -5/+5 |
| | |||||
* | [Minor] Try to fix OOB reads | Vsevolod Stakhov | 2020-03-31 | 1 | -1/+1 |
| | |||||
* | [Project] Track more memory allocations in a task | Vsevolod Stakhov | 2019-12-23 | 1 | -0/+1 |
| | |||||
* | [Minor] Unify converters usage | Vsevolod Stakhov | 2019-11-19 | 1 | -5/+16 |
| | |||||
* | [Minor] Fix compile warnings | Vsevolod Stakhov | 2019-10-10 | 1 | -2/+2 |
| | |||||
* | [Minor] Fix one more received case | Vsevolod Stakhov | 2019-10-01 | 1 | -3/+3 |
| | |||||
* | [Fix] Fix parsing of the received headers with empty part | Vsevolod Stakhov | 2019-10-01 | 1 | -4/+12 |
| | |||||
* | [Fix] Distinguish remote and local addrs parsing | Vsevolod Stakhov | 2019-09-28 | 1 | -5/+12 |
| | |||||
* | [Minor] Some small style fixes | Vsevolod Stakhov | 2019-09-25 | 1 | -3/+3 |
| | |||||
* | [Minor] Copy&paste fix for copy&paste OOB access | Vsevolod Stakhov | 2019-09-25 | 1 | -1/+1 |
| | |||||
* | [Minor] Some sanity check | Vsevolod Stakhov | 2019-09-25 | 1 | -1/+1 |
| | |||||
* | [Rework] Use opaque structure to store a table of mime headers | Vsevolod Stakhov | 2019-08-13 | 1 | -11/+43 |
| | |||||
* | [Project] Empty messages cases handling | Vsevolod Stakhov | 2019-07-12 | 1 | -1/+1 |
| | |||||
* | [Minor] Fix some cases of strong headers usage | Vsevolod Stakhov | 2019-07-12 | 1 | -0/+2 |
| | |||||
* | [Project] Fix some final issues | Vsevolod Stakhov | 2019-07-12 | 1 | -4/+8 |
| | |||||
* | [Project] Fix init parts | Vsevolod Stakhov | 2019-07-12 | 1 | -9/+18 |
| | |||||
* | [Project] Further rework of mime headers processing | Vsevolod Stakhov | 2019-07-12 | 1 | -50/+86 |
| | |||||
* | [Project] Start mime structures refactoring | Vsevolod Stakhov | 2019-07-12 | 1 | -11/+11 |
| | |||||
* | [Minor] Fix processing message ids without braces | Vsevolod Stakhov | 2019-05-24 | 1 | -19/+19 |
| | |||||
* | [Fix] Fix Content-Type parsing | Vsevolod Stakhov | 2019-02-18 | 1 | -54/+55 |
| | | | | Issue: #2757 | ||||
* | [Minor] Oops, fix memory drainage | Vsevolod Stakhov | 2019-02-08 | 1 | -0/+7 |
| | |||||
* | [Fix] Add some more cases for Received header | Vsevolod Stakhov | 2019-02-08 | 1 | -93/+148 |
| | |||||
* | [Minor] Fix memory issue | Vsevolod Stakhov | 2019-02-07 | 1 | -7/+12 |
| | |||||
* | [Minor] Fix `with` parsing | Vsevolod Stakhov | 2019-02-07 | 1 | -2/+10 |
| | |||||
* | [Fix] Fix processing of null bytes in headers | Vsevolod Stakhov | 2019-02-07 | 1 | -5/+22 |
| | | | | Issue: #2742 | ||||
* | [Project] Attach new received parser | Vsevolod Stakhov | 2019-02-07 | 1 | -11/+37 |
| | |||||
* | [Project] Add more details to received parser | Vsevolod Stakhov | 2019-02-07 | 1 | -49/+124 |
| | |||||
* | [Project] Add heuristical from parser to received parser | Vsevolod Stakhov | 2019-02-06 | 1 | -10/+222 |
| | |||||
* | [Project] Add spilling machine for received headers | Vsevolod Stakhov | 2019-02-06 | 1 | -0/+331 |
| | |||||
* | Revert "Revert "[Fix] Use decoded values when parsing mime addresses"" | Vsevolod Stakhov | 2018-12-10 | 1 | -4/+4 |
| | | | | This reverts commit a4255c642865592ed07c79113d78c86d1650d27c. | ||||
* | [Feature] Allow to get task flags in C expressions | Vsevolod Stakhov | 2018-11-29 | 1 | -2/+13 |
| | |||||
* | [CritFix] Strictly deny unencoded bad utf8 sequences in headers | Vsevolod Stakhov | 2018-11-27 | 1 | -1/+25 |
| | |||||
* | Revert "[Fix] Use decoded values when parsing mime addresses" | Vsevolod Stakhov | 2018-01-25 | 1 | -4/+4 |
| | | | | This reverts commit 352a465639b64e024e54e25b76d59e4e68b798b5. | ||||
* | [Minor] Delivered-to is not intended to be unique | Vsevolod Stakhov | 2018-01-20 | 1 | -1/+1 |
| | |||||
* | [Fix] Replace space like characters in headers with plain space | Vsevolod Stakhov | 2017-12-26 | 1 | -2/+8 |
| | |||||
* | [Minor] Set pointer to NULL after usage to avoid confusion | Vsevolod Stakhov | 2017-12-15 | 1 | -3/+4 |
| | |||||
* | [Fix] Use decoded values when parsing mime addresses | Vsevolod Stakhov | 2017-12-06 | 1 | -4/+4 |
| | | | | Not MFH, needs testing... | ||||
* | [Fix] Check decoded headers sanity (e.g. by excluding \0) | Vsevolod Stakhov | 2017-12-06 | 1 | -0/+15 |
| | | | | MFH: rspamd-1.6 | ||||
* | [Fix] Fix empty headers simple canonicalization | Vsevolod Stakhov | 2017-11-03 | 1 | -1/+2 |
| | | | | | Issue: #1904 MFH: rspamd-1.6 | ||||
* | [Feature] Implement headers flags in mime parser | Vsevolod Stakhov | 2017-10-02 | 1 | -8/+16 |
| | | | | MFH: rspamd-1.6 | ||||
* | [Refactor] Correct misspelled `rspamd_smtp_recieved_parse` | Alexander Moisseev | 2017-06-28 | 1 | -1/+1 |
| | |||||
* | [Minor] Add workaround for ISO-2022-JP encoding | Vsevolod Stakhov | 2017-06-12 | 1 | -2/+12 |
| | | | | Issue: #1669 |